Debbie-Rand Memorial Service League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 1,669,069 | 606,690 | 1,062,379 | 26.0 | 0% |
| 2013 | 405,940 | 1,076,140 | −670,200 | 7.2 | 0% |
| 2014 | 580,040 | 780,367 | −200,327 | 6.8 | 0% |
| 2015 | 516,138 | 670,709 | −154,571 | 5.2 | 0% |
| 2016 | 615,769 | 620,292 | −4,523 | 5.6 | 0% |
| 2017 | 575,225 | 580,425 | −5,200 | 5.9 | 0% |
| 2018 | 620,211 | 575,150 | 45,061 | 6.9 | 0% |
| 2019 | 203,086 | 22,000 | 181,086 | 268.3 | 0% |
| 2020 | 694,331 | 638,839 | 55,492 | 6.3 | 0% |
| 2021 | 569,977 | 644,425 | −74,448 | 4.4 | 0% |
| 2022 | 651,336 | 465,621 | 185,715 | 13.3 | 0% |
| 2023 | 766,561 | 771,328 | −4,767 | 8.0 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$4,767 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 8 months of spending, down from 26 in 2012.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
